What Is Thyroid Ablation?
Thyroid ablation is a minimally invasive procedure that uses
controlled energy to destroy targeted tissue within a thyroid nodule.
One commonly used method is Radiofrequency Ablation. During RFA, a thin
electrode is inserted into the nodule under real-time ultrasound guidance.
Radiofrequency energy generates controlled heat, which treats the
targeted tissue.
After treatment, the nodule does not disappear immediately. Instead,
the treated tissue gradually decreases in volume over the following
months.
Why Is Thyroid Ablation Performed?
Not every thyroid nodule requires treatment.
Small benign nodules that are not causing symptoms may simply be
monitored with periodic ultrasound examinations.
Treatment may be considered when a nodule:
• Continues to grow
• Produces visible neck swelling
• Causes pressure or
discomfort
• Makes swallowing
difficult
• Creates significant
cosmetic concerns
• Produces excess thyroid
hormone in selected cases
Before recommending ablation, doctors need to establish the nature of the
thyroid nodule and determine whether it is appropriate for minimally
invasive treatment.
Who Is a Candidate for Thyroid Ablation?
Thyroid ablation is mainly considered for selected patients with
benign thyroid nodules that are symptomatic or cosmetically problematic.
Before treatment, the patient usually undergoes a detailed thyroid
ultrasound. Depending on the ultrasound appearance and clinical situation,
FNAC or core needle biopsy may be required to confirm that the nodule is
benign.
Patient selection may also consider:
• Nodule size
• Nodule composition
• Location within the
thyroid
• Symptoms
• Thyroid hormone levels
• Previous biopsy results
• Overall medical
condition
• Patient preference
A complete evaluation is essential because not every thyroid nodule
should be treated with ablation.
How Is Thyroid Radiofrequency Ablation Performed?
The procedure is performed using ultrasound guidance.
First, the thyroid nodule and surrounding neck structures are
carefully evaluated. Local anesthesia is commonly administered to reduce discomfort.
A specialized radiofrequency electrode is then introduced into the
nodule.
Using real-time ultrasound, the specialist precisely controls the
position of the electrode and applies energy to selected portions of
the nodule.
This precision is important because the thyroid is located close to the
airway, blood vessels, nerves, and other sensitive structures.

Is Thyroid Ablation Better Than Surgery?
There is no single treatment that is best for every thyroid nodule.
Thyroid ablation may provide an alternative to surgery for
appropriately selected benign nodules, particularly when the objective is
to reduce nodule volume while preserving normal thyroid tissue.
Surgery may still be more appropriate when there is:
• Confirmed thyroid cancer
• Strong suspicion of
malignancy
• A nodule unsuitable for
ablation
• Significant compression
requiring surgery
• Multiple thyroid
abnormalities requiring surgical treatment
• Another medical
indication for thyroid removal
Therefore, the choice between thyroid ablation and surgery should
be made after a detailed specialist evaluation.
Can Thyroid Ablation Treat Cancer?
The established role of thermal ablation is strongest for appropriately
confirmed benign thyroid nodules. Ablation may also be used for
selected thyroid cancers in specialized settings and carefully chosen
patients, but it should not be considered a routine substitute for standard
cancer treatment.
Any suspicious thyroid nodule requires proper diagnostic evaluation
before ablation is considered.
What Happens After Thyroid Ablation?
Some patients may experience mild neck discomfort, swelling, or tenderness
shortly after the procedure.
The nodule then gradually reduces in volume over time.
Follow-up is an important part of treatment and may include:
• Thyroid ultrasound
• Measurement of nodule
size
• Assessment of symptoms
• Thyroid function tests
when appropriate
• Evaluation for residual
or regrowing tissue
Some nodules may require additional treatment if adequate volume
reduction is not achieved or if significant regrowth occurs.
Why Is Ultrasound Guidance Important?
Thyroid ablation requires precise targeting.
Real-time ultrasound allows the specialist to see the nodule, electrode,
blood vessels, and surrounding structures throughout the procedure.
This helps deliver treatment to the intended tissue while minimizing
unnecessary exposure of nearby structures.
